Body
Origins and Family
Édouard Trouette's place of birth was Saint-Denis[2]. Recorded date of birth include +1855-01-01T00:00:00Z[3] and +1855-04-15T00:00:00Z[10]. His father was Émile Trouette[12].
Education
Édouard Trouette's education included a stint at Lycée Saint-Louis[17].
Career and Affiliations
Recorded occupations include botanist[6], pharmacist[7], researcher[8], and municipal councillor[9]. Employers include hôpital de la Pitié[15], a hospital[27], in France[28], founded in 1612[29] and Saint-Antoine Hospital[16], a hospital[30], in France[31], founded in 1791[32].
Recognition
Édouard Trouette received the Knight of the Legion of Honour[18].
Personal Life
A child of Édouard Trouette was Jean Trouette[13].
Death and Burial
Édouard Trouette died on +1924-09-15T00:00:00Z[5]. He passed away in 17th arrondissement of Paris[4]. Burial took place at Cimetière de Montrouge[11].
